микроБЛОГ
помощь
установка

и так. поехали.

  1. качаем последнюю версию нашего любимого с вами микроблога отсюда;
  2. распаковываем для начала весь архив на локальный компьютер;
  3. изменяем settings.php;
  4. с помощью фтп-клиента(или любыми другими путями), закачиваем микроблог на свой фтп-сервер;
  5. для полной работы микроблога осталось только назначить на некоторые файлы и папки дополнительные права доступа:
    chmod 0777 sess.php
    chmod 0777 data/
    chmod 0666 data/plugins
    chmod 0777 data/posts/
    chmod 0777 data/comments/
    chmod 0777 data/blocks/
    chmod 0777 data/blocks/header/
    chmod 0777 data/blocks/left/
    chmod 0777 data/blocks/right/

    777 - чтение, выполнение, запись - для всех
    666 - чтение, запись - для всех;
  6. все. микроблог в начальной поставке готов выслушать ваши мысли и записать их в папку data/posts/, а всякого рода комментарии, в папку data/comments.

PS. слышал, что baxi собирается сделать автоматическую установку микроблога на ваш сервер. так что ждем, господа лентяи и криворучки :)

наверх

использование

тут даже незнаю что комментировать: нажимаем ссылку login в верхнем правом углу, вводим пароль, который вы же указали в settings.php, на главной странице появляются новые ссылки: Add post, Admin Panel, Logout.

Add post - добавить запись;
Admin Panel - управление плагинами/блоками и прочее;
Logout - снять с себя права администратора :)

Если вы хотите разбить длинный пост, то в нужном вам месте необходимо вставить тэг <cut text="Читать дальше"> именно так, с кавычками и прочими магическими символами.

например, если написать пост:
Раз два три <cut text="Читать дальше"> четыре пять

пост будет иметь вид:
Раз два три
Читать дальше

а "четыре пять" вы увидете только когда перейдете по ссылке.

наверх

плагины

плагины служат для добавления функциональности для нашего маленького друга микроблога. даже скорее добавляют удобство для хозяина микроблога, т.к. мы прекрасно знаем: микроблогу хватает все.
известные на сегодняшний день плагины:

  1. Last.FM 0.1 by cewil - последние 10 треков из LAST.FM;
  2. Smiles Atrium 0.1 - замена смайлов на графические;
  3. HookName 0.2 by cewil - запоминает имя комментирующего;
  4. Comment2Mail 0.1 by baxi - отправляет комментарии на эл.адрес хозяина;
  5. Ago 0.1 by baxi - как много времени прошло с момента записи;
  6. Microtime 0.1 by baxi - время генерации страницы;
  7. Calendar v1.1 - самый долгожданный календарь.

как устанавливать тот или иной плагин - небуду, это забота разработчика того самого плагина. ибо в установке плагина не должно быть никаких трудностей. единственное - не забывайте включать плагин в admin panel

наверх

шаблоны

то что используется в микроблоге, это скорее всего не шаблоны, а какие-нибудь модульные составляющие дизайна :) сам придумал. не бить. все эти составляющие лежат в папке data/tpl и впринципе понятны по своим названиям.

важно знать, что в этих файлах содержатся переменные, они заключены такого рода скобки <?=@$... ?> это менять не следует.

  1. comment.html - как выглядит комментарий к записи;
  2. comment_form.html - форма для комментария;
  3. day.html - настройка вывода даты. в последних версиях не используется;
  4. foother.html - низ страницы;
  5. head.html - заголовок;
  6. left.html - левый блок (настраивается в админ.панели);
  7. login_form.html - форма ввода пароля;
  8. post.html - ваш пост;
  9. post_form.html - форма для ввода поста;
  10. post_list.html - список постов за месяц;
  11. right.html - правый блок (настраивается в админ.панели).

файлы left.html и right.html на вашем месте я бы не трогал :) если вы незнаете что делаете.

разработчики плагинов могут менять стандартные файлы шаблонов на свои.
например: если у вас установлен плагин hook_name, то шаблон comment_form.html находится в его папке data/hookname и править вам надо его.

наверх

rss (с) http://lenta.pskov.ru/rss.html

что такое rss

RSS - это интернет-технология, которая позволяет осуществлять трансляцию материалов сайта. Трансляция данных осуществляется в специальном формате, на языке XML.

Как это работает?

Транслируемые данные хранятся в специальном файле, который расположен на сайте-владельце. Специальные программы позволяют загружать этот файл с данными из интернета в автоматическом режиме, экономя трафик и время. Вам не придется каждый раз заходить на все эти сайты - вы будете видеть заголовки новостей и читать только то,что вас действительно заинтересует.

Для чего это нужно?

Если Вы регулярно работаете в интернете и при этом просматриваете большое количество сайтов на предмет появления свежей информации (например, новостей, биржевых сводок и пр.), то RSS просто создан для Вас.

Как этим пользоваться?
  1. Для чтения RSS вам необходимо установить на своем компьютере специальную программу. Таких программ существует достаточно много. Например, вот эти бесплатные - Abilon, RssReader, FeedReader - или платные - GetNews, NewzCrawler и многие другие. Читать обзор программ.
  2. После установки программы вам необходимо указать программе адрес файла трансляции, например такой: http://informpskov.ru/admin/export_rss.php. Часто владельцы сайтов указывают адрес файла трансляций в виде ссылки под такой или вот такой картинкой. Если вы заметили на сайте такие значки, то скорее всего вы можете получать обновления сайта с помощью своей программы.
  3. В некоторых программах вы можете указать частоту проверки обновлений сайта и задать ряд других параметров.
  4. Вот и все! Теперь программа загрузит данные из интернета и отобразит их.

Подробнее oб RSS можно почитать здесь или поискать здесь.

RSS экспортер для микроблога можно взять здесь, изменить в нем настройки на свои и положить в корень папки микроблога.

наверх

admin panel

доступна после ввода пароля. здесь вы можете управлять плагинами, блоками, ну и все пожалуй :) для микроблога этого пока достаточно.
вам чего-то нехватает? думаю автор вас всенепременно выслушает и, скорее всего добавит, когда у него появится на это время.

если админ панель недоступна, проверьте, выставлены ли права доступа 777 (чтение, выполнение, запись) на файл sess.php в корневой папке микроблога.

наверх

xmlrpc
XMLRPC

Есть возможность добавлять записи в свой блог не через веб-интерфейс, а через программы, использующие XMLRPC библиотеку.

Очень удобно постить записи через программу w.bloggar
Для этого:

- Качаем программу отсюда (w.bloggar 4.00.0191 Full Setup 2 Mb);
- Качаем этот архив и распаковываем в корень микроблога.

Итак, скачали, установили, запускаем.

При первом запуске Вас встретит "мастер добавления аккаунта"
- говорим ему что у нас уже есть свой замечательный блог Yes, I want to add it as a new account. и жмем 'Next';
- На следующем шаге из списка выбираем 'Custom' (самый последний элемент списка);
- Вводим Account Alias (например Microblog, неважно что), 'Next';
- Posts: metaWeblogAPI; Categories/Templates: Not Supported; 'Next'
- Здесь вписываете свои данные: Host - имя сервера. Path - путь до файла xmlrpc.php.

например:
host: microblog.bakmil.com
path: /xmlrpc.php

Галочку HTTPS можете отключить в 2-х случаях: если не работает с ней и, если не страдаете параноей :)
'Next';

- В поле User: впишите microblog. Ничего другого, в Password свой пароль, который указан у Вас в settings.php

Все. После нажатия кнопки Finish вы не должны увидеть никаких поздравлений или ошибок. Если все прошло гладко, вы увидете главное окно программы, с которой, я надеюсь не трудно разобраться. :)

наверх

пока все, что смог вспомнить. задавайте вопросы. icq 6067444
составитель cewil.:.
Rambler's Top100